Chapter 79 Disappearance, the Clues Gone
......Atlanta.
A white van was traveling along the railway line, gradually approaching the lifeless city.
"...He better be alright."
Inside the carriage, Daryl stared at T-boy with a sinister gaze and said in an unfriendly tone:
"I only have one sentence to say."
Although he didn't say much, everyone could hear the threatening tone in his words.
"...I told you, the walkers can't get close to him, only we can open that door."
T-boy sat back and looked at him directly, not avoiding his unfriendly gaze.
"..."
The carriage fell silent again.
The truck drove in silence along the railway line into the city, finally stopping near its destination.
Glenn parked the truck beside the tracks, then turned to them and said:
"Let's start walking from here."
The truck was left here to facilitate their evacuation.
None of them objected. They picked up their weapons and equipment and got off the truck one after another, walking towards their destination.
At Daryl's insistence and Glenn's "professional" advice, they decided to rescue Moore first and retrieve the bag of guns on their way back.
Led by Glenn, they deliberately chose secluded paths and arrived at the department store without attracting the attention of the zombies.
Because they attracted one group when they left, and another group was attracted by Li Ailun and his group, the number of zombies in this area has decreased significantly.
They entered the building through the back door and carefully made their way to the main lobby, which was the only way to get to the rooftop.
Fortunately, there was only one female zombie in the hall. Perhaps because she retained some memories from her previous life, she was wandering around the clothing area.
"Ho...ho..."
The female zombie in the skirt smelled the presence of living people and began to stagger toward them.
Rick didn't choose to fire, fearing the sound would alert the zombies. He signaled to Daryl to use a crossbow to deal with them.
Daryl understood. He cautiously approached the female zombie, then raised his crossbow and aimed at its face. Looking at the zombie's hideous and disgusting face, he muttered:
"Damn it, you disgusting clown."
puff......
An arrow was fired, and the female zombie fell to the ground.
Without further delay, the group immediately ran into the stairwell, and a few minutes later, they finally reached the rooftop.
However, what they saw was an open iron gate, and several zombie corpses lying in the stairwell and at the doorway.
"......"
Everyone turned to look at T-boy.
He had been so adamant that he had locked the door, but now...
“Moll...Moll..."
Daryl didn't bother to settle scores with him; he rushed in, shouting his brother's name.
"I...I don't know..."
T-boy was stunned when he saw this.
"It was cut open..."
Rick observed neat breaks in the lock, indicating that someone had killed the walker and then cut the lock from the outside to get in.
"Do not......"
"Do not......"
Daryl's loud roar came through.
Without thinking twice, Rick and his two companions quickly stepped over the corpses on the ground and entered the rooftop.
However, the body of Moor, which they had imagined, was not found.
There was only a small, conspicuous pool of blood on the ground, along with a small, bloodstained saw, and an empty pair of handcuffs hanging on a metal frame.
"..."
The group fell silent.
It was obvious that the saw couldn't cut the handcuffs at all, and they all thought that this was Moore's only way to save himself, which was a really cruel method.
"..."
Daryl was so enraged that he suddenly turned around, picked up his crossbow, and aimed it at T-boy, as if he wanted to avenge his brother.
T-boy was being held at gunpoint by a crossbow, so naturally he was too scared to move.
"I won't hesitate..."
Seeing this, Rick raised his revolver and pointed it at Daryl's head, saying firmly:
"I don't care if the gunshots attract the zombies from the city."
"..."
Daryl glared at T-boy, but seeing that he was completely at T's mercy, he finally put down his crossbow.
Daryl knew his brother's troublemaking nature and understood that the greatest responsibility for all of this lay with his brother.
Seeing the crossbow bolts move away, T-boy breathed a sigh of relief.
"Things might not be as bad as they seem..."
Seeing that Daryl had calmed down, Rick began to analyze the situation, saying:
"The iron gate was clearly opened from the outside, so someone must have rescued Moore."
Rick walked over, squatted down in front of the metal pipe to examine it, and then turned to Daryl and said:
"The handcuffs were cut, and there was too little blood on the ground, so Moore's hands should have been saved."
Daryl finally calmed down after hearing this; he had only been momentarily enraged and had overlooked the details.
But now another problem has stumped them.
[Who exactly saved Moore? And where did they take him?]
"By the way, did you guys notice that just now?"
Glenn suddenly spoke up, and seeing that they had all turned to look at him, he continued:
"There were two zombie corpses at the emergency exit on the third floor. Were they killed by those people?"
Reminded by Glenn, they also remembered seeing the zombie's body in the stairwell when they came up, but they hadn't paid much attention to it because they were in a hurry to get up.
"Let's go... let's see if we can find any clues as to how they left."
Rick stood up and said to them.
So the group went back the way they came and arrived at the emergency exit on the third floor.
Two bodies lay motionless on the ground. They also found wire cutters and a crowbar lying on the ground, deducing that the people had used them to block the door.
The wire cutters on the ground were definitely the ones used to cut the lock and handcuffs, which means they came back from the rooftop. It seems they were forced back by the walkers when they went downstairs...
"Moll... are you there...?"
Daryl walked straight into the building, carrying his crossbow and shouting as he went.
"We're not the only ones here..."
Rick couldn't help but remind him.
"Who cares..."
Daryl was so anxious to find her brother that she couldn't care less about anything else.
Glenn, who was very nervous behind him, suddenly remembered something and said:
"If they left from this floor, I know where they are..."
Seeing that the group was looking at him with puzzled expressions, Glenn didn't waste any words. He checked the direction and then said to them:
"Follow me..."
After saying that, he took the lead and walked forward, and the others quickly followed.
......
"here......"
Led by Glenn, they easily found the bakery.
The bakery was still dimly lit, with tables and chairs overturned on the floor, and everything was in a mess.
"Are you sure this is here?"
Rick, holding his pistol warily, looked at Glenn and asked.
There is only one escape exit on this floor.
Glenn nodded, then pointed towards the kitchen and said:
"...It's inside."
The group cautiously entered the kitchen and, sure enough, found another zombie corpse on the ground.
But the most conspicuous thing was the broken window, with the body of a zombie hanging on the windowsill, completely blocking the gap.
"That's it, the emergency staircase for this building is right outside..."
Glenn pointed to the window, then turned to the group and explained:
"It was discovered during the previous search of the building, and Moore knew about it too."
"..."
Daryl gave Glenn a deep look, then walked straight to the window. He first kicked the walker's foot, but there was no response; it was clearly dead.
He then completely lowered his guard, reached out and pulled the zombie's body down, revealing a huge gap in the window.
Daryl peered out of the opening and, sure enough, saw the escape staircase.
It's obvious that the people who rescued Moore left from here.
However, the trail went completely cold here.
"..."
Daryl didn't even think about it and was about to crawl through the gap when Rick grabbed him from behind.
With his operation thwarted, Daryl turned and glared at Rick, warning him in an unfriendly tone:
Take your hand away...
There are at least 1000 zombies outside.
Rick ignored Daryl's warning and instead pulled him back, reminding him:
"...You can't just go out like this without any clue."
"Say what you will, I'm going to find him."
Daryl, however, refused to listen to advice.
He moved directly in front of Rick, staring him in the eye with a displeased expression, but said in an unusually firm tone:
"You can't stop me..."
“He is your family, I understand.”
I also went through a lot of hardship to find my family, so I completely understand how you feel.
Rick looked at him, showing no dissatisfaction with Daryl's attitude, and instead spoke to him sincerely:
"There are zombies everywhere outside, and we have absolutely no clue about those people. If we want to find Moore, we need to stay clear-headed."
"..."
Daryl looked into his sincere eyes and gradually calmed down.
"...That's not difficult."
He then realized that as long as his brother didn't die here, he believed that with his brother's strength, he would definitely be able to escape the city.
"very good......"
Rick nodded when he saw that he had finally calmed down and regained his senses.
Then, Rick walked over to the two zombie corpses, knelt down, and began to examine them carefully...
.......
